1. Blessed are you who fear the Lord and walk in his ways.

2. You will eat the fruit of your toil; you will be blessed and favored.

3. Your wife, like a vine, will bear fruits in your home; your children, like olive shoots will stand around your table.

4. Such are the blessings bestowed upon the man who fears the Lord.

5. May the Lord bless you from Zion. May you see Jerusalem prosperous all the days of your life.

6. May you see your children's children, and Israel at peace!
